> Hi Stan,
>
> file upload it not mandatory to the submission process. If you set
> webui.submit.upload.required = false in the dspace.cfg
> you can submit items without bitstreams.
>
> Are you one managing metadata? In that case there are tools for
> collaborative reference management which might be more appropriate for this
> use case.
